The Mud Hill Spur trail is 1.0 miles long. It begins at Forest Bndry and ends at Forest Bndry. The trail is open for the following uses: Horseback Riding
Getting there
From Rifle go south under the I-70 overpass and head east on Airport Road to County Road 315 (Mamm Creek Rd). Follow that approximately 7 miles to CR316. Drive about 1 mile to a 4 wheel drive road on the right and head south to end of road at BLM boundary. Mud Hill Forest trailhead is about 4 miles south of the BLM boundary.
